Title :
Empirically Analyzing the Necessity of EICMM Ranking by Clustering

Abstract :
In this paper, the necessity of ranking of the enterprise´s informatization capacity maturity is researched on the basis of EICMM (Enterprise Informatization Capacity Maturity Model). Based on the EICMM, we adopt the proper method (Cluster Analytical Method) for the empirical research, commence from the evaluated index system, design the questionnaires and collect the related data of informatization, and handle and analyze the collated findings of the surveys and questionnaires by means of CABOSFV (Clustering Algorithm Based on Sparse Feature Vector) algorithm and explain the holds of the assumption of stratification and ranking of EICMM by resorting to the conclusion of such empirical analysis.
